Air Europa has signed a memorandum of understanding (MoU) with Airbus for up to 40 A350-900 aircraft. The deal was announced during the Dubai Airshow 2025.
The aircraft will accelerate the renewal of Air Europa's fleet renewal.
“This order is a strategic milestone in Air Europa's fleet development, accelerating its profitable growth by renewal of the current widebody fleet,” said Air Europa president Juan Jose Hidalgo. “The A350-900 is a game-changer for key destinations in Latin America.”
“We are committed to supporting Air Europa's ambitious growth strategy as they leverage the A350's capabilities for their future long-haul operations," said Airbus EVP sales of the commercial aircraft business Benoit de Saint-Exupery.
